Sitemi WordPress’ten Github’a Taşıdım

Neden WordPress çok iyi biliyorum. Bir sürü eklenti ile istiğim gibi şekillendirebiliyorum sitemi. Sürekli güncellenmesi ile de her zaman güvenli ve stabil çalışıyor. Hala WordPress’e bayılıyorum ama bir süre sonra sürekli güncellemeler sıkmaya başladı. Bazı eklentilerin uyumsuzluluğu, çakışması da işin tuzu biberi oldu. Ben de bir değişiklik yapayım dedim. Adım 1 Worpress sitemi HTML’ye çevirmem gerekiyordu. bunun için Teleport programını …

SQL Sunucunuz Neden Hantal Çalışıyor?

İlk nedeni tabii ki donanımdır. Yeterince güçlü bir sunucunuz yoksa tabii ki yavaş çalışır. Ama dikkat edin 16 çekirdekli bir işlemci alınca SQL Sunucu lisansı sizi batırmasın. İkinci nedeni Windows’tur. Server 2003 veya 2008 kullanmak hızını etkiler. Ama 32 bit işletim sistemi kullanmak daha fazla etkiler. Aynı şekilde 32 bit SQL Sunucu kullanmak da işlemlerinizi yavaşlatır. SQL Sunucunun garip bir özelliği var. Eğer bilgisayarda yeterince RAM …

Kendi Windows Sunucunuza Visual Studio için GIT Kurulumu

Bildiğiniz gibi GIT; yazılım geliştirmede kullanılan bir sürüm kontrol ve kaynak kod yönetim sistemidir. GIT sürüm kontrol sistemini kullanan her bir çalışma dizinini (yani projeyi), internet erişimi ya da merkezi bir depo olmaksızın tüm tarihçeyi tutan ve sürüm kontrol sisteminin tamamını içinde barındıran tam yetkili birer depodur. GİT’in en önemli özelliği açık kaynaklı ve ücretsiz olması. Kurulumu ve öğrenmesi kolay bir sistem. …

Windows’ta DOS Oyunları Çalıştırmak

DOS 1995’te bitmişti. Oysa Windows Xp kullanırken bile DOS oyunları ile ilgili bir problem yoktu. Hangi oyunu çalıştırmayı denesek hemen bir DOS penceresi açılır sonra da oyun başlardı. 16-bit program desteği diye bir şey vardı. Ne olduysa XP ile Vista arasında geçen 6 yılda oldu. Artık eski programlar yeni Windows’larda çalışmıyor. Microsoft’tun Windows ekibinde 1992’den beri çalışan bir yazılımcı olan Raymond Chen …

WordPress Multisite neden kullanılmamalı?

Eminim herkes wordpress.com sitesini duymuştur. Çok farklı bir sistem. Nasıl çalışıyor hiç çözememiştim. Ta ki wordpress multisite diye bir şey ortaya çıkıncaya kadar. Bizim sunucuda ondört adet site var. Bu yüzden bir ara ben de kullanmak istedim bu sistemi. Lakin multisite ile sunulan sistem bu çeşit farklı sitelerde çalışacak  şekilde planlanmamış. Tüm sitenin altyapı ve sisteminin aynı, sadece sub-domain’lerdeki sayfaların …

Windows Server 2012 üzerinde MySQL Tablolarını Otomatik Yedekleme

Ben sisteme en güncek programları kurarak işe başladım. MySQL server’ı kurduğumda veri dosyalarını “C:\ProgramData\MySQL\MySQL Server 5.1\data\” adlı klasöre attığını fark ettim. Burada her veritabanı için ayrı birer klasör oluşturulmuştu. Yani tek yapmam gereken bu klasörleri bir şekilde yedeklemek. Eğer her klasörü ayrı bir zip dosyasına atıp dosya adı olarak da günün tarihini verirsem süper bir yedekleme sistemi kurarım dedim. MsSQL …

Windows Server’da WordPress Permalinks Kullanımı

Bu işlemi yapabilmek için sunucunuz üzerinde wordpress sitenizin sorunsuz çalıştığını varsayıyorum. WordPress kurulumunun sitenin ana sayfasında olması gerekiyor. Eğer alt dizinde ise linkleri ona göre düzenlemeniz gerekiyor. İlk önce Windows Server’a “URL Rewrite” özelliğinin kurulması gerekiyor. WordPress Permalinks aktifleştirilmesi gerekiyor. WordPress ayarlar menüsünden “Kalıcı Bağlantılar” tıklanır. İstene format seçilir ve değişiklikler kaydedilir. Şimdi sitedeki bir linke tıkladığınızda 404 hatası verecektir. …

Windows Server’da MySQL Şifresi Değiştirme

Kolay Yol MySQL’i suncuya “Microsoft Web Platform Installer” aracılığyla yüklemisseniz “root” kullanıcısının şifresi sunucunun “administrator” hesabının şifresi ile aynıdır. Bu yüzden değiştirmesi kolaydır. Eğer “MySQL Workbench” bilgisayarınızda yoksa  mutlaka yükleyin, yüklüyse çalıştırın. Açılan ekranın sağ tarafında “Server Administration” yazan bölümdeki “Local “MySQL” yazınısa çift tıklayın. Şu anki MySQL root şifresini girin. ilk defa giriyorsanız muhtemelen windows administrator şifresiyle aynıdır. Değilse aşağıdaki …